The ingredients needed to make Loaded Spinach Stuffing:
  1. Get 1/2 baguette; medium cubed
  2. Make ready 4 C beef stock
  3. Get 3 cloves garlic; smashed & peeled
  4. Make ready 1 stalk celery; small dice
  5. Take 1/2 red bell pepper; medium dice
  6. Take 1/2 red onion; medium dice
  7. Prepare 1 pinch crushed pepper flakes
  8. Prepare 1 pinch kosher salt & black pepper
Steps to make Loaded Spinach Stuffing:
  1. Heat beef stock, garlic, and pepper flakes in a small sauce pot. Reduce to 2 C. Discard garlic for another use.
  2. In a large mixing bowl, combine bread cubes, bell pepper, onions, and spinach. Add beef stock and a pinch of salt and pepper. Mix to combine.
  3. Spread stuffing in an ungreased casserole dish. Cover. Bake at 375° for 20 minutes. Uncover. Bake an additional 20-25 minutes or until stuffing is no longer soggy.
